Beyond the numbers

## What each city asks you to trade

Costs and scores help narrow the choice. These practical strengths and limitations finish the picture.

[Lyon](https://jobicy.com/cost-of-living/france/lyon.md)
France

→

### Strengths

* Excellent public transport, cycling infrastructure, and walkable central districts

* High-quality healthcare and safe drinking water

* Strong food culture with markets, bouchons, and diverse international dining

* Fast fiber internet and reliable mobile coverage

* More affordable and less tourist-saturated than Paris

* Easy rail access to Paris, the Alps, Provence, and Switzerland

### Trade-offs

* Long-term housing can be competitive and requires extensive paperwork

* French bureaucracy and banking setup can be slow for newcomers

* Winter can be gray, chilly, and affected by temperature inversions

* English is less universal outside international workplaces and tourist areas

* Summer heatwaves are increasingly common

* France has no dedicated digital nomad visa

### Common visa routes

* Schengen short-stay visa or visa-free entry: up to 90 days in any 180-day period

* French long-stay visitor visa for stays over 90 days, subject to financial and insurance requirements

* Passeport Talent residence permit for eligible entrepreneurs, founders, and highly skilled workers

[Manila](https://jobicy.com/cost-of-living/philippines/manila.md)
Philippines

→

### Strengths

* Widespread English fluency makes daily life straightforward

* Affordable food, services, and domestic help

* Strong café, mall, and coworking infrastructure

* Excellent access to beaches and islands via domestic flights

* Friendly, social culture with a large international community

* Convenient app-based delivery and ride-hailing services

### Trade-offs

* Severe traffic can make short distances take a long time

* Heat, humidity, flooding, and typhoons affect daily routines

* Air quality is often poor near major roads

* Sidewalks and pedestrian infrastructure are inconsistent

* Tap water is not suitable for drinking

* Power and internet can be disrupted during major storms

### Common visa routes

* Visa-free entry or visa-on-arrival eligibility for qualifying nationalities

* Tourist visa extension through Philippine immigration

* Philippine Digital Nomad Visa, subject to current rollout and eligibility rules

Reading the result

## Use this as a planning benchmark

The headline score compares six directional signals. It does not weight personal priorities, visa eligibility, household size or individual lifestyle choices.

Costs are monthly estimates, not guaranteed prices.
Higher is better for quality scores and connectivity.
Lower is better for budgets and individual expenses.
